What Is Previs and Why Does It Matter for Ice Fishing?
Previs is like a rough draft for your video. In traditional filmmaking, directors use simple 3D models to plan camera angles and actor movements before the real shoot. For ice fishing, that means you can plan your shots—the wide establishing shot of the lake, the close-up on the tip-up, the reaction shot of your buddy—before you even step foot on the ice.

Cost-Effective Trial and Error
One of the biggest advantages of previs is that it's cheap to iterate. If you don't like the camera angle, you just adjust the path in the 3D scene. No need to regenerate the entire video, which can cost money and time. For ice fishing videos, where the conditions are unpredictable, being able to plan your shots ahead of time can save you from wasting a good fishing day on a bad shot.
But it's not always necessary. For simple shots—like a single person jigging in a static frame—you might just use a prompt. Previs shines when the shot is complex: multiple characters, a long take, or a camera that moves in a specific way. It's a tool for the moments when you need to get it right the first time.
